To prevent the mat from becoming 
caught under the pedals:
-
 
ensure that the mat and its fixings 
are positioned correctly
,
-
 
never fit one mat on top of another
 .
Maximum weights on bars
-
 
Roof rack: 120 kg.
-
 
T
 ransverse bars on roof: 100 kg.
-
 
T
 ransverse bars on longitudinal 
bars: 75 kg. Installation of radiocommunication 
transmitters
Before installing accessory 
radiocommunication transmitters with 
an external aerial on your vehicle, you 
are advised to contact a CITR
o Ë n  
dealer.
A CITROËN dealer can inform you of 
the specifications (frequency band, 
maximum output power, aerial position, 
specific installation conditions) of the 
transmitters which can be fitted, in 
accordance with the Motor Vehicle 
Electromagnetic Compatibility 
Directive
  (2004/104/CE).

We draw your attention to the 
following points:
- The fitting of electrical equipment or 
accessories not listed by CITROËN
  may 
cause faults and failures with the electrical 
system of your vehicle. Contact a CITROËN 
dealer for information on the range of 
recommended accessories.
-
 
As a safety measure, access to the 
diagnostic socket, used for the vehicle's 
electronic systems, is reserved strictly for 
CITROËN dealers or qualified workshops, 
equipped with the special diagnostic 
tool required (risk of malfunctions of the 
vehicle's electronic systems that could 
cause breakdowns or serious accidents). 
The manufacturer cannot be held 
responsible if this advice is not followed.
-
 
Any modification or adaptation not intended 
or authorised by 
Automobiles CITROËN or 
carried out without meeting the technical 
requirements defined by the manufacturer 
would lead to the suspension of the legal 
and contractual warranties.
